引言
前端埋点技术是现代数据分析体系中的关键组成部分,它能够帮助我们收集用户行为数据,从而为产品优化、营销策略调整和用户体验提升提供有力支持。本文将全面解析前端埋点,从基础概念到实际操作,帮助读者轻松掌握数据分析的核心技巧。
一、前端埋点概述
1.1 什么是前端埋点
前端埋点是指在前端代码中添加特定的标记或脚本,用于记录用户在网站或应用上的行为数据,如页面访问、点击事件、滚动行为等。这些数据经过处理后,可以用于分析用户行为、优化产品设计和提升用户体验。
1.2 埋点的作用
- 用户行为分析:了解用户在网站或应用上的行为模式,为产品优化提供依据。
- 营销效果评估:评估营销活动的效果,为后续营销策略调整提供数据支持。
- 用户体验优化:根据用户行为数据,优化产品设计和交互,提升用户体验。
二、前端埋点技术
2.1 埋点类型
- 页面访问埋点:记录用户访问页面的时间、次数等信息。
- 点击事件埋点:记录用户点击的元素,如按钮、链接等。
- 滚动行为埋点:记录用户在页面上的滚动行为,如滚动距离、停留时间等。
- 表单提交埋点:记录用户提交表单的行为,如填写内容、提交时间等。
2.2 埋点实现方式
- JavaScript埋点:通过JavaScript代码实现,灵活度高,但需要前端工程师具备一定的编程能力。
- SDK埋点:使用第三方数据分析平台的SDK进行埋点,操作简单,但可能存在数据隐私问题。
- 可视化埋点:通过可视化工具进行埋点,无需编写代码,但功能相对有限。
三、前端埋点实践
3.1 埋点规划
- 明确目标:确定埋点目的,如用户行为分析、营销效果评估等。
- 定义指标:根据目标,定义需要收集的数据指标,如页面访问量、点击次数等。
- 选择工具:根据需求选择合适的埋点工具或平台。
3.2 埋点实施
- 编写埋点代码:根据所选工具或平台,编写相应的埋点代码。
- 测试验证:在开发环境中测试埋点代码,确保数据收集准确无误。
- 上线部署:将埋点代码部署到生产环境。
3.3 数据分析
- 数据清洗:对收集到的数据进行清洗,去除无效或错误数据。
- 数据可视化:将数据可视化,便于分析。
- 数据挖掘:根据数据分析结果,挖掘有价值的信息。
四、前端埋点注意事项
- 数据安全:确保用户数据安全,遵守相关法律法规。
- 性能优化:避免过度埋点导致页面加载缓慢。
- 代码规范:编写规范的埋点代码,便于维护和扩展。
五、总结
前端埋点技术在数据分析中扮演着重要角色。通过本文的全面解析,相信读者已经对前端埋点有了更深入的了解。掌握前端埋点技巧,将有助于提升产品品质、优化用户体验,为企业的可持续发展提供有力支持。
